A 74 year old businessman is headed to jail for stealing from the Detroit school district. On Tuesday, U.S. District Judge Victoria Roberts says that Norman Shy’s sentence should stand as a deterrent for others tempted to steal from the district. Shy has been sentenced to five years in jail, after being convicted in a bribery and kickback scheme involving a dozen principals and one administrator.
